Tasting Notes

A sleeper of the vintage, this cuvee, made by Ausone’s Alain Vauthier, possesses a dark purple color as well as an elegant perfume of cold steel interwoven with crushed rocks, white flowers, blueberries, and licorice. With terrific fruit, medium body, sweet tannin, and a long, layered finish, it can be drunk now and over the next decade.

89
Robert Parker, Wine Advocate (164), April 2006
